Deer Park Middle School is a mid-sized middle school in Deer Park, Washington, enrolling 503 students.
At 16.8:1, its student-teacher ratio sits close to the Washington median, within a few percentage points of the 17.6:1 state norm, neither notably crowded nor notably small.
Its free-meal eligibility rate of 44.2% lands close to the Washington typical range, neither a high- nor low-need campus by this measure.
Enrollment of 503 puts it in the larger third of Washington schools by headcount.
Its Resource Investment Index lands in the lower third of 2,394 scored Washington schools.
Among 501 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Washington schools statewide, it ranks #395,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is predominantly White (85% of enrollment), among the less diverse in the state (diversity index 26/100).
Counselor access is stretched at roughly 503 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.
Attendance runs somewhat below the norm, with 22.3% of students chronically absent per the 2021-22 civil-rights collection.
The surrounding Deer Park School District spends $13,679 per pupil, 30% below the Washington average, a leaner-resourced district than most.
Deer Park School District also operates Deer Park High School (637 students) and Deer Park Home Link Program (617 students) alongside Deer Park Middle School.
